Transcription is a process that consists of the synthesis of a single strand of mRNA, from one of the DNA strands, which will be used as a template strand.

The enzyme responsible for the transcription process is RNA polymerase which, based on the nucleotide sequence of the DNA strand, will add complementary nucleotides to the mRNA strand following the rule of base complementarity:

If DNA has:        Complement in mRNA it is:

Adenine                Uracil (no thymine in RNA)

Thymine                Adenine

Cytosine               Guanina

Guanine                Cytosine
